Last month it was reported in Detroit that close to 1,000 students and volunteers may have been exposed to deadly asbestos at a historic Detroit landmark. The volunteers worked over 75,000 hours this summer cleaning up the aging Michigan Central Train Station.

The historic landmark has been an eyesore for area residents and its owner that had been under pressure to begin renovations. The volunteers spent the summer shoveling and sweeping debris, but state inspectors have now discovered asbestos in some of the materials that were handled.

Since asbestos can be easily aerosolized when disturbed it has raised great concern from many of the students and volunteers. The asbestos could have been breathed during the renovations which could dramatically increase one’s chance of developing lung cancer. Cancers associated with asbestos exposure sometimes take decades to appear.

People who may have been exposed to asbestos are encouraged by asbestos medical professionals to consider getting a complete pulmonary function test, physical examination and a low dose chest x-ray. According to health experts these tests should be repeated at 5 year intervals for at least 3 series to monitor for any future medical problems.
